“Live and Work,” by Stephen
Stephen, in “Live and Work” mentions a story about a hard working father who delivered bread as a support for his wife and three children. He spent most of his time in his work and attending classes in order to provide his family with money for living. Beside this, his family always complained, “You don’t spend enough time with us,” but he reasoned that he was doing all this for them. As a result, all of his hard work paid off, and he became a senior supervisor; therefore, he could afford to provide his family with life’s little luxuries like nice clothing and vacation abroad. However, Stephen further states that the father continued to work very hard, hoping to be promoted to the position of manager and he did. Consequently, he bought a beautiful condominium overlooking the coast of Singapore. On the first Sunday evening at their new home, he was going to devote more time to his family, but he didn’t wake up the next day.
In sum, the author describes the actions very well, which makes the story more interesting. It is a touching story, which gives us a clear idea that we should balance our life and career. In addition, we should be happy with what we have and enjoy every single moment in our lives. However, I did not like the ending of the story. It is too sad; I always prefer happy ending. Furthermore, he didn’t mention what happened to the family after the father passed away. In conclusion, I recommend this nice-moral story that teaches us great lessons in order to have better life.
